Will Smith is the victim of an Internet death hoax

June 2nd, 2011 - 2:15 am ICT by Aishwarya Bhatt  

Los Angeles, June 1 (THAINDIAN NEWS) Actor Will Smith is the latest victim of the celebrity Internet death hoax. His fans needn’t be worried as he is safe and sound. According to reports, the death hoax started on the web site FakeAWish.com. This particular site gives users the facility to create news about a celebrity using their just their first and last names.

The news originated from here and soon spread like wildfire through tweets on the popular social networking and microblogging site Twitter. What made the hoax even more credible was a trustworthy looking article about the hoax from ‘Global Associated News’. Many people fell for the hoax and invariably they spread it even further by discussing the topic on Twitter and on other social networking sites.

Will Smith was named ‘Willard Christopher ‘Will Smith, Jr.’ at birth. He is also known as ‘The Fresh Prince’. He was born on the 25th of September 1968. He has made a name for himself in Hollywood in his capacity as an actor, producer and even as a rapper. Four years ago, he was also honored with the title of the most powerful actor on the planet.
